Magick is real. It's also highly illegal-not that I'm worried about that.
Sure, I heal faster than most, and I've got a sixth sense for brewing teas that can fix just about any problem, but my café isn't exactly a hotbed of paranormal activity.
At least it
wasn't
... until some psycho attacked me and woke up the freaky, forbidden magick inside, earning me a one-way ticket to jail.
Now, a secretive magickal university is offering me a deal: my freedom in exchange for help with the Tarot prophecies-cryptic predictions they believe hold the key to stopping a deadly apocalyptic plot.
Predictions only
I
can decipher.
Because the witch who divined them? She died years ago.
I should know. She was my mother.
Grab your grimoires, girls. Magick school's officially in session.
All I have to do now is master my powers, decode the doomsday prophecies, outwit a mean-girl coven that puts the
psycho
in psychic, and survive the temptations of one
very
naughty professor and three scorching-hot, overprotective mages shadowing my every move.
There's only one problem.
If I'm right about the prophecies? Survival isn't in the cards for
any
of us.
